Duro-Last Inc. Honors 2023 Contractor of the Year, Annual Project Awards

Michigan-based Duro-Last celebrated the hard work of its contractors during its 38th annual National Sales Seminar, naming its 2023 Contractor of the Year and recognizing outstanding projects from the past year.

Held Jan. 22-24 at Loews Hollywood Hotel in Hollywood, Calif., the seminar welcomed more than 1,200 guests representing more than 230 certified Duro-Last roofing contractor companies. The event featured educational sessions, networking, company news and product announcements. It was also a time to honor the work and accomplishments of 2022.

“Our 38th annual sales seminar in Hollywood was an event unlike any other in the roofing industry,” Duro-Last CEO Tom Saeli said. “It is an opportunity to celebrate, educate and learn from and with our contractors. We set records for square footage produced and sold in 2022, and we’re optimistic about 2023. The time we spend at Seminar each year with our contractors ensures we understand their upcoming needs, and it gives us an opportunity to achieve our mission — to ‘wow our customers all ways always.’” 

Contractor of the Year Award

Duro-Last’s 2022 Contractor of the Year is Royalty Roofing from Seymour, Ind. Royalty Roofing earned the Contractor of the Year distinction for its exceptional work, attention to detail, customer service and outstanding sales throughout 2022. Royalty Roofing, an authorized Duro-Last contractor for more than 25 years, also earned the distinction of being the first-ever recipient of the Duro-Last Platinum Eagle Award based on exceptional sales for 2022. 

Project Awards

Six project awards were presented to contractors in the following categories:

Project of the Year

Recognizing the project that best utilizes all aspects of a Duro-Last Roofing System and demonstrates a dedication to outstanding workmanship, best practices, innovation and customer service.

  • Contractor: Mid-Western Commercial Roofers from Mobile, Ala.
  • Project: First Baptist Church in Biloxi, Miss.

Custom-Fabrication Award

Recognizing the project that best utilizes Duro-Last’s custom-fabricated membrane and accessories throughout the roofing system.

  • Contractor: Damschroder Roofing from Freemont, Ohio
  • Project: Arch Building, The Andersons in Maumee, Ohio 

Edge-to-Edge & Deck-to-Sky™ Award

Recognizing the project that best utilizes Duro-Last products for the entire roofing system – from Edge-to-Edge & Deck-to-Sky.

  • Contractor: Old South Construction Company from Wetumpka, Ala.
  • Project: Riverton Intermediate School in Huntsville, Ala.

Metal Roofing Award

Recognizing the project that best utilizes EXCEPTIONAL® Metals metal roofing and wall panels.

  • Contractor: PMR Roofing from Dallas
  • Project: Val Verde County Courthouse in Del Rio, Texas

Specialty Membrane Award

Recognizing the project that best utilizes Duro-Last roll good products. 

  • Contractor: Great Lakes Roofing and Insulation Systems, Inc. from Sault Saint Marie, Mich.
  • Project: Treetops Resort in Gaylord, Mich.

Sustainability Award

Recognizing the project that best utilizes Duro-Last products or services to reduce the environmental impact of the building.

  • Contractor: Royalty Roofing Inc.
  • Project: Crothersville Junior/Senior High School in Crothersville, Ind.
